Trying to create an SQL data source. I have SQL 2008 and while "Test Server" is successful, "Test Database" comes back with the error..

"Unable able to connect to the database!"

"Invalid object name 'Connections'."

Go-to File -> My Data Sources -> find your data source -> Edit -> Upgrade (tab) -> click on create and/or upgrade buttons.
